Career path

Career Opportunities in Plant Genetic Resource Preservation & Utilization (UK)

Role Description
Plant Geneticist Research and development of new plant varieties, focusing on genetic improvement for yield, disease resistance, and climate resilience. High demand, excellent career prospects.
Plant Breeder Developing improved crop varieties through traditional breeding techniques and advanced genomic selection. Strong skills in plant genetics and agronomy are crucial.
Seed Technologist Specialized knowledge in seed production, storage, and quality control, ensuring the preservation of plant genetic resources. Growing demand in sustainable agriculture.
Germplasm Curator Management and conservation of plant genetic resources in genebanks, ensuring the long-term preservation of biodiversity. Essential role in food security.
Bioinformatician (Plant Genomics) Analysis of large genomic datasets to identify genes related to important traits and assist in plant breeding programs. Strong computational skills are essential.
